What happens to diarrhea after taking Chinese medicine?

Diarrhea generally refers to diarrhea. Diarrhea after taking traditional Chinese medicine is considered to be caused by stimulation of traditional Chinese medicine ingredients, allergy to traditional Chinese medicine, deterioration of traditional Chinese medicine, etc.
1. Stimulation of traditional Chinese medicine ingredients
If the patient takes bitter and cold traditional Chinese medicine, such as scutellaria, coptis chinensis, rhubarb, etc., it can stimulate the gastrointestinal mucosa and cause diarrhea.
2. Allergy to traditional Chinese medicine
If the patient is allergic to traditional Chinese medicine, it may cause allergic reactions, such as abdominal pain, diarrhea, nausea, vomiting, rash, skin itching, allergic shock, etc.
3. Deterioration of traditional Chinese medicine
If the traditional Chinese medicine is not properly preserved, it may cause a large number of bacteria, causing acute gastroenteritis, and then diarrhea.
